Brendan Gaffney
Brendan Gaffney joins Blue State Digital as a researcher and strategist after working as the research director at Wal-Mart Watch. As research director, Brendan helped spearhead the effort to make Wal-Mart a better corporate citizen by writing reports, producing website content, and conducting employee outreach. Prior to his work at Wal-Mart Watch, he was a media analyst at the Thunder Road Group during the 2004 Presidential Election and a research analyst with America Coming Together. Brendan has also worked for the Office of Inspector General at the U.S. Department of Labor.
Brendan holds a BA in History and Political Science from the George Washington University. A Massachusetts native, he resides in Maryland.

my.barackobama.com
Then-Senator Barack Obama retained BSD to manage the online fundraising, constituency-building, issue advocacy, and peer-to-peer online networking aspects of his 2008 Presidential primary campaign. Critically important to President Obama's victory in November 2008 was his campaign's use of the BSD Online Tools Suite. The campaign utilized BSD's tools to mobilize over 3 million individual donors to contribute over $500 million online, to motivate over 2 million social networking participants, and to create and promote more than 200,000 offline events across the country.
